        In  conclusion,  the  incorporation  of  Machine  Learning  and  the  Internet  of  Things  into
        desalination systems has the potential to revolutionize the method by which freshwater
        is created from salty sources. This might have a significant impact on the global water
        supply. These technologies offer a path toward more sustainable, efficient, and reliable
        desalination  processes  by  enabling  real-time  monitoring,  predictive  maintenance,  and
        data-driven decision-making. This contributes to the relief of water scarcity concerns on a
        worldwide  scale.  This  investigation  offers  important  takeaways  for  researchers,
        engineers, and politicians who are interested in putting the potential of machine learning
        and the internet of things to use in the desalination industry.
